The Amazon basin, the world's largest remaining tropical rain forest, is experiencing rapid ecological and socio-economic changes. This book examines the forces behind these changes and considers current threats to the forests and their biodiversity. Various strategies for conserving forests and other regional resources are outlined, with an emphasis on the critical role of the private sector.
